The book explores the transformation of the Republican Party during Donald Trump's leadership, highlighting the emergence of cult-like dynamics within the political landscape. It examines Trump's charismatic authority, his dogmatic approach, and his tendency to reject criticism, drawing parallels to characteristics often seen in cult leaders. Through this lens, the author delves into the implications of these changes for the party and its followers.
